语音聊天SDK免费试用如何实现语音识别关键词?

随着移动互联网的快速发展,语音聊天SDK在各大平台的应用越来越广泛。许多开发者为了提升用户体验,纷纷推出语音聊天SDK免费试用活动。然而,如何实现语音识别关键词功能,成为了许多开发者面临的一大难题。本文将为您揭秘语音聊天SDK免费试用如何实现语音识别关键词的奥秘。

一、语音识别技术概述

语音识别技术是指将语音信号转换为文本信息的过程。目前,市面上主流的语音识别技术包括深度学习、隐马尔可夫模型(HMM)等。其中,深度学习技术在语音识别领域取得了显著的成果,尤其在语音识别准确率方面。

二、语音识别关键词实现方法

  1. 关键词库构建

首先,需要构建一个包含目标关键词的库。这些关键词可以是用户在语音聊天中经常提到的词汇,也可以是根据业务需求设定的特定词汇。例如,在客服领域,关键词可以包括“订单”、“售后”等。


  1. 语音识别API调用

在构建好关键词库后,开发者可以通过调用语音识别API来实现语音识别功能。目前,市面上许多语音识别服务提供商,如百度、科大讯飞等,都提供了便捷的API接口。


  1. 关键词识别算法

为了提高关键词识别的准确率,开发者可以采用以下算法:

  • 动态时间规整(DTW)算法:用于解决语音信号长度不一致的问题,提高语音识别的准确率。
  • 隐马尔可夫模型(HMM):通过训练大量的语音数据,学习语音信号的规律,提高关键词识别的准确率。

  1. 关键词匹配与处理

在识别到关键词后,系统需要对关键词进行匹配和处理。例如,当识别到“订单”关键词时,系统可以自动跳转到订单查询页面;当识别到“售后”关键词时,系统可以自动跳转到售后咨询页面。

三、案例分析

以某电商平台为例,该平台为了提升用户体验,推出了语音聊天SDK免费试用活动。通过以上方法,实现了语音识别关键词功能。当用户在聊天过程中提到“订单”关键词时,系统会自动跳转到订单查询页面,方便用户快速查看订单信息。

四、总结

语音聊天SDK免费试用实现语音识别关键词功能,需要从关键词库构建、语音识别API调用、关键词识别算法以及关键词匹配与处理等方面进行综合考虑。通过不断优化和改进,可以提升语音识别关键词的准确率和用户体验。

猜你喜欢:rtc sdk